description Product Description

Human pituitary growth hormone, iodination grade, is a high-purity preparation used primarily in research and diagnostic applications for labeling with radioiodine to create tracers essential for radioimmunoassays (RIA). It enables the precise measurement of growth hormone levels in biological samples, aiding in the study of growth disorders and endocrine function. Additionally, it serves as a critical tool in the development and validation of immunoassays, ensuring accurate detection and quantification of growth hormone in clinical and laboratory settings. Its high purity and specific activity make it suitable for sensitive labeling and analytical techniques.
